Abstract

The utility model discloses a reservoir water level monitoring and early warning device, and relates to the technical field of water level monitoring. The utility model comprises a stand column, wherein a rectangular channel is formed in the middle of the stand column; the water level detection mechanism comprises a mounting ring which is sleeved on the surface of the upright post in a sliding manner, an annular air bag is arranged at the edge of the bottom of the mounting ring, and a mounting plate is connected between the inner side walls of the mounting ring. According to the utility model, the water level detection mechanism and the intelligent early warning mechanism are arranged, when the intelligent water level monitoring device is used, the mounting ring can always float on the water surface under the buoyancy action of the annular air bag, the infrared light generator of the distance sensing device is matched with the infrared receiver, the real-time monitoring of the water level of the reservoir can be realized by calculating the drop, meanwhile, the control panel can receive the signal of the distance sensing device, and when the water level of the reservoir is too high or too low, the alarm is controlled to give an alarm, so that the working personnel can conveniently make timely countermeasures according to the water level.

Technical Field
The utility model relates to the technical field of water level monitoring equipment, in particular to a reservoir water level monitoring and early warning device.
Background
Reservoirs, commonly referred to as "hydraulic engineering structures for flood control and water storage and regulation, can be utilized for irrigation, power generation, flood control and fish farming. "it means an artificial lake formed by constructing a barrage at a throat of a mountain ditch or river. After the reservoir is built, the effects of flood control, water storage irrigation, water supply, power generation, fish culture and the like can be achieved. Sometimes natural lakes are also called reservoirs (natural reservoirs). Reservoir sizes are generally divided into small, medium and large sizes according to reservoir capacity.
At present, the method adopted in the aspects of reservoir management and dam safety monitoring in China is mainly a manual inspection method, a marker post is erected in a reservoir, and a manager judges the water level condition of the reservoir by checking scale marks on the marker post, so that the method can be easily realized under the condition of good daytime vision, but the method becomes very inconvenient at night or in overcast and rainy days, and therefore, the reservoir water level monitoring and early warning device is provided to solve the problems.

Detailed Description
In order to make the objects, technical solutions and advantages of the embodiments of the present utility model more clear, the technical solutions of the embodiments of the present utility model will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present utility model.
The application provides a reservoir water level monitoring and early warning device, which is mainly used for solving the problem that water level monitoring is inconvenient in night or overcast weather in the prior art, and provides the following technical scheme, and the following detailed description is made with reference to fig. 1-4:
A reservoir level monitoring and early warning device, comprising:
the middle part of the upright post 1 is provided with a rectangular channel 101;
the water level detection mechanism 2 comprises a mounting ring 201 which is sleeved on the surface of the upright column 1 in a sliding manner, an annular air bag 202 is arranged at the edge of the bottom of the mounting ring 201, a mounting plate 203 is connected between the inner side walls of the mounting ring 201, the mounting plate 203 is inserted into the rectangular channel 101 in a sliding manner, an infrared light generator 204 is arranged on the inner top wall of the rectangular channel 101, and an infrared light receiver 205 is arranged in the middle of the top of the mounting plate 203;
The intelligent early warning mechanism 3 comprises an installation cylinder 301 fixedly arranged at the top of the upright column 1, a control panel 302 is installed on one side of the installation cylinder 301, an alarm 303 is installed on the other side of the installation cylinder 301, and input ends of the infrared light generator 204, the infrared receiver 205 and the alarm 303 are electrically connected with output ends of the control panel 302;
and the fixing frame 4 is arranged at the bottom of the upright post 1 and is used for fixedly mounting the upright post 1 in a water body.
This reservoir water level monitoring early warning device is when using, stand 1 is installed in the water through mount 4 earlier, the collar 201 is under the buoyancy effect of annular gasbag 202, can float on the surface of water all the time, distance sensing device infrared light generator 204 and infrared receiver 205 cooperation can realize the real-time supervision to reservoir water level through calculating the fall, compare traditional manual work and look over the mark, more accurate, control panel 302 can accept distance sensing device's signal in addition, when reservoir water level is too high or when too low, will control alarm 303 sends the police dispatch newspaper, make things convenient for the staff to make timely countermeasure according to the water level.
It should be noted that, the external light generator and the infrared receiver 205 are components of an infrared distance sensor, which is in the prior art, one of the products is TCRT5000, and the specific working principle thereof will not be described in detail.
As shown in fig. 1, in some embodiments, the column surface of the column 1 is sequentially sprayed with three color bands 5 of red, yellow and green from top to bottom, more specifically, by setting the color bands 5, the staff can help quickly determine the approximate water level of the reservoir, the red color band 5 is located in a section area at the top of the column 1, when the water level reaches the red color band 5 area, the danger or warning is indicated, the yellow color band 5 is located in a section area below the red color band 5, when the water level is located in the yellow color band 5 area, the warning or early warning is indicated, the green color band 5 is located in a section area below the yellow color band 5, and when the water level phase is located in the green color band 5 area, the safety or normal state is indicated.
As shown in fig. x, in some embodiments, the side of the mounting ring 201 is annularly provided with an arc 206, and the annular air bag 202 is adhered to the inner side of the arc 206, more specifically, the arc 206 is connected with the edge of the mounting ring 201, and takes the shape of an annular, and the function of supporting and protecting the air bag is provided by the arc 206, so that the air bag can stably work.
As shown in fig. 3, in some embodiments, a solar panel 6 is installed at the top of the installation cylinder 301, a storage battery 7 is installed inside the installation cylinder 301, the output end of the solar panel 6 is electrically connected with the input end of the storage battery 7 through a photovoltaic inverter, the output end of the storage battery 7 is electrically connected with the input end of the control panel 302, more specifically, the design can utilize solar energy to charge and supply power to the control panel 302 in the water level monitoring and early warning device, the solar panel 6 converts sunlight into electric energy, the electric energy is transmitted to the storage battery 7 for storage after being processed by the photovoltaic inverter, the storage battery 7 is used as a power supply, stable electric power can be provided for the control panel 302, normal operation of the device and operation of the intelligent early warning mechanism 3 are ensured, the design has the characteristics of environmental protection and energy saving, external power supply is not needed, energy consumption and operation cost can be reduced, meanwhile, the existence of the storage battery 7 can also maintain the power supply of the device under the condition of no solar energy supply at night or in cloudy days, and the like, and reliability and durability of the device are ensured.
As shown in fig. 3, in some embodiments, the top surface of the mounting cylinder 301 is an inclined surface, and more specifically, this design may allow the solar panel 6 to better receive sunlight and improve solar energy conversion efficiency, and by tilting the top of the mounting cylinder 301, the solar panel 6 may better face the sun and absorb solar energy to the maximum.
As shown in fig. 1, in some embodiments, the fixing frame 4 includes an annular array of extension plates 401 at the bottom of the upright 1, a jack is configured on one side of the extension plates 401 away from the upright 1, and a fixing pile 402 is inserted in the jack, a reinforcing plate 403 is connected between the side wall of the upright 1 and the middle part of the extension plates 401, more specifically, the combination of the extension plates 401, the reinforcing plate 403 and the fixing piles 402 provides stable support and fixing, the combination of the jack of the extension plates 401 and the fixing piles 402 can enable the fixing frame 4 to be better fixed in the water, the jack can be reasonably inserted in the fixing piles 402 to increase the overall stability, the reinforcing plate 403 connects the side wall of the upright 1 and the middle part of the extension plates 401, and further structural stability and bearing capacity are enhanced, and the overall rigidity of the fixing frame 4 can be enhanced.
